I don’t really know to be honest. On one hand, it could be very possible that there are humans in the Banished since Atriox doesn’t seem to care what species are fighting for him. He managed to get the brutes and elites to fight on the same side even though they have been enemies since Great Schism, so he could probably get humans to fight alongside him too as long as they obey his orders. There could’ve been insurrectionist groups that joined him as well.
On the other hand, we haven’t really fought any enemy humans during the games. We might’ve had human enemies or something like that in the past, such as the corrupt police officer in H3 ODST, but no full on armies/groups like the Covenant or Banished. There were also mentions of insurrectionists in Halo Reach, but we never actually fought them in the game either. Because of this, it would be the first time we fight humans in a mainline Halo game, which could be a little odd. It’s definitely possible in DLC for Halo Infinite, but I don’t think its too probable that we fight our own species during the main campaign.
